Terms | Definitions |
|---|---|
cephalo | head |
cephalocaudad | proceeding toward the tail from the head |
cephalodynia | headache |
encephalo | brain |
encephalitis | inflammation of the brain |
cyclo | a cycle, circular |
cyclopledgia | paralysis of the ciliary muscle, causing loss of accomodation |
cortico | outer region |
corticospinal | pertaining to the cerebral cortex and the spinal cord |
gnoso | knowledge |
prognosis | foreknowledge |
diagnosis | process of determining the nature of a disorder |
glio | glue, neurological tissue |
neuroglia | non conducting cells of nervous tissue with supportive and metabolic functions |
ganglio | ganglion, knot, swelling |
post-ganglionic | distal to or beyond a ganglion |
medullo | soft, inner part |
medullary | pertaining to the marrow or to any medulla |
lacrimo | tear |
lacrimation | secretion of tears |
lacrimal | relating to the tears |
kera | hard, horny, cornea |
keratinization | keratin formation |
keratitis | inflammation of the cornea |
mio | less or smaller |
miosis | constriction of the pupil |
meiosis | cell division comprising two nuclear divisions in rapid succesion |
meta | after, beyond, change |
metaphysis | the flared portion of a long bone |
metastasis | the transfer of disease from one organ or tissue to another |
meso | middle, mesentery |
mesencephalon | the midbrain |
mesocolon | the mesentary that attach the colon to the posterior wall of the abdominal cavity |
nystagmus | an involuntary, rhythmic oscillation of the eyeballs |
myopia | nearsightedness |
mydriasis | dilation of the pupil of the eye |
ptosis | a falling, downward displacement |
gastroptosis | downward displacement of the stomach |
opto | relationship to the eye or to vision |
optometrist | a non-medical specialist who measures powers of vision |
ophthalmo | eye |
ectomy | excision; surgical removal of a segment or entire portion of an organ |
gastrectomy | surgical removal of the stomach |
appendectomy | surgical removal of the vermiform appendix |
telo | end or ending |
telencephalon | the anterior portion of the brain |
telophase | the final stage of mitosis or meiosis |
sclero | hardness, relationship to the sclera of the eye |
sclerosis | the process of becoming extremely firm or hard |
scleritis | inflammation of the sclera |
ostomy | to furnish with a mouth; an artificial or sugical opening |
gastrostomy | establishing an artificial opening into the stomach |
colostomy | surgical operation in which a part of the colon is brought through the abdominal wall in order to drain or compress the intestine |
opia | condition of vision, process of viewing |
hyperopia | farsightedness |
autopsy | post mortem examination of a body to determine cause of death |
ist | one who specializes in |
pharmacist | individual who is liscenced to prepare and dispense drugs and has extensive knowledge of their properties |
arthro | a joint or articulation |
arthritis | inflammation of one or more joints |
blepharo | eyelid |
blepharoptosis | drooping of the upper eyelid |
blepharedema | edema of the eyelids |
